What Is Neurofeedback?

Neurofeedback is a form of biofeedback for the brain. It uses real-time monitoring of your brainwave activity via EEG sensors to provide feedback that teaches your brain how to self regulate.

Why are brainwaves so important?

Your brain operates using electrical rhythms called brainwaves. Each type of brainwave supports different mental, emotional, and physiological functions.

Balancing brainwaves is like tuning an instrument. Neurofeedback gently helps your brain “tune itself” toward calm, clear, and adaptive states.

When these waves are out of balance—too fast, too slow, or incoherent—you may experience:

Trouble focusing

Chronic anxiety

Poor sleep

Mood swings

Disconnection or emotional numbness

Types of Brainwaves

Delta
Deep sleep, immune repair

Theta
Subconscious, creativity, memory

Alpha
Calm alertness, absorption, mental flow

Beta
Focus, logic, executive function

Gamma
Integration, learning, insight, peak performance

The Neurofeedback Methods We Offer

We tailor your brain training program using a variety of scientifically validated approaches.

Infra-Low Frequency Neurofeedback (ILF)

Trains deep regulatory brain functions through extremely slow frequencies. Promotes emotional regulation, stability, and calm.

Best for:

  • Trauma
  • Anxiety
  • Stress
  • ADHD
  • Personality Disorders
  • Developmental Disorders

Low Energy Neurofeedback System (LENS) Neurofeedback

Uses ultra-low electromagnetic signals to reset and reorganize stuck brain patterns. Sessions are brief, powerful, and require no screen or sound. Excellent for sensitive nervous systems, concussions, fatigue, or overstimulation.

Best for:

  • Cognitive Fog
  • PTSD
  • OCD
  • Anxiety
  • Depression
  • Chronic Pain

Body LENS Therapy

A gentle, body-based approach to calming the nervous system. Uses ultra-low signals to release stored stress in the body. Helps regulate the nervous system and restore a sense of safety. Complements talk therapy, somatic work, and traditional LENS sessions.

Best for:

  • Trauma
  • Chronic Tension
  • Sensitivity
  • Emotional Shutdown

Synchrony Training

Produces meditative, unified brain states using fractal visuals and sound. Improves sense of safety and openness in the body.

Best for:

  • Social Anxiety
  • Attachment Issues
  • Mindfulness Enhancement

Alpha-Theta Neurofeedback

Accesses subconscious healing states using guided imagery and binaural beats. Ideal for emotional processing and inner transformation.

Best for:

  • Trauma Resolution
  • Addictions
  • Inner Healing

Biofeedback & Heart Rate Variability (HRV) Training

Syncs breath with heart rhythms for deeper parasympathetic activation. Often used before neurofeedback to enhance brain learning capacity.

Best for:

  • Anxiety
  • Tension
  • Chronic Stress
  • Pain
  • Migraines

Frequently Asked Questions

Leave blank
How many sessions will I need?

Most people notice improvements within the first 4–6 sessions. For lasting results, a typical program runs 20–40 sessions depending on your goals and symptoms.

Is it safe?

Yes. Neurofeedback is non-invasive and medication-free. We use FDA-cleared systems and tailor treatment to your unique nervous system.

Will I feel anything during the session?

No. Neurofeedback is painless and relaxing. You may feel calmer or more centered after a session, but the learning happens beneath conscious awareness.

What if I’m already on medication?

Neurofeedback can be done alongside medication. Many clients are eventually able to reduce or eliminate medication under their doctor’s supervision.

How does LENS differ from other methods?

LENS is quicker and does not rely on visuals or effort. It’s ideal for sensitive systems, brain fog, fatigue, or clients who struggle with traditional feedback-based training.
